Just because the NFL regular season is over doesn't mean fantasy football season is completely over. That's right, it's time once again for the fantasy football playoff challenge!

It's a different game than the regular-season version. In case you need help here, we did a strategy guide to break down how to win it a few years back (SPOILER: You need to prioritize QBs first!).

Here's how it works: you draft a standard lineup of players who are in the postseason, but instead of head-to-head games, the winner is based on who has the most total fantasy points by the time the Super Bowl is over.

The key here is to focus on which players will play in the most playoff games. So while, say, Jordan Love is a pretty good fantasy QB normally, he may play only one game (sorry, Packers fans).
